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Adderley Park to Barrow Haven start from as little as £24.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Adderley Park to Barrow Haven are available for £65.10 one way, or £100.80 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Adderley Park station ensures travel convenience with ticket machines available for those who purchase tickets online. While there is no dedicated ticket office on Mondays, staff presence is available on most days. Travelers can expect helpful departure screens and announcements to stay updated about their journey. Although the station lacks fully accessible facilities, step-free access is partially available, and ramps can be provided for train access upon request.

The station doesn’t currently offer some amenities like refreshment facilities, but its strategic location means there's always something nearby in Birmingham to quench your thirst or satisfy any snack cravings. While toilets and baby changing facilities are also unavailable, the station is under CCTV surveillance, adding a layer of security for travelers and their properties. For bikers, a small cycling storage area is present, albeit unsheltered.

Onward Travel Options

Adderley Park is not just about train travel. It integrates seamlessly with other local transport options, offering easier navigation around the bustling city of Birmingham and beyond. In the case of rail service disruptions, rail replacement vehicles board from Bordesley Green Road, right outside the station entrance. Local bus services by West Midlands buses provide frequent and robust connections throughout the city. For those looking to travel comfortably without a personal ride, taxis are readily available with local companies like Embassy and TOA, which can be contacted for services directly to your next destination.

Essential Station Facilities and Customer Services

While Barrow Haven maintains a minimalist approach, particularly when it comes to ticketing, it ensures ease of access for all passengers. The station has no ticket office or ticket machines, and smartcards are not issued or validated here. However, if accessibility is a concern, you’ll be pleased to know that the station offers step-free access throughout, making it welcoming for wheelchair and limited mobility travelers.

Customer information might not be staffed, but the presence of a help point ensures that assistance is at hand if required. Notably, the induction loop system is in place to aid individuals with hearing impairments. For any inquiries or lost property issues, you can reach out to the station’s helpline during standard hours.

Onward Travel Options

Barrow Haven station positions itself as a convenient link to an array of transportation options. For additional travel arrangements, a Rail Replacement service can be accessed at The Haven Inn, Ferry Road, a short distance away. While there are no direct bus services from the station, travelers can find bus route information tailored to onward journeys available for print.
